Some houses remember. Some mirrors do more than reflect.
Sixteen-year-old Mara Ellison wants nothing to do with Briar House, the decaying family home where her older sister Elise vanished. Her mother says they only need to stay long enough to settle the estate. Mara knows better. The covered mirrors, the locked rooms, and the photographs that refuse to keep Elise’s face all point to the same impossible truth: something in the house has been waiting for them to come back.
When Mara touches the old glass, she finds rooms that should not exist, memories that change when she looks too closely, and a girl trapped behind a door no one was supposed to open. Each trip through the mirrors brings her closer to Elise—and closer to the thing wearing familiar faces from the other side.
What the Glass Remembers is a slow-burn YA psychological horror novel about sisters, grief, haunted inheritance, and the terrifying cost of being remembered by the wrong thing.
